How CoolCore™ technology works
AirZuma is built on a proven scientific principle: evaporative cooling. The air drawn in by the device passes through a moistened medium that lowers its temperature before releasing it. It is the same natural mechanism that cools your skin when sweat evaporates, optimised and accelerated by CoolCore™ technology.
Unlike a fan, which simply moves the already-warm air around the room, AirZuma produces a stream of air that is genuinely cooler than what enters it. And unlike an air conditioner, it does not strip humidity from the atmosphere: you avoid that dry-air feeling, the irritated throat and the itchy eyes on waking.
